Design And Testing Of Wind Deflectors For Roof-mounted Solar Panels

It was concluded that an elliptically profiled wind deflector, with uniformly spaced short fins that were positioned before the tilted panels, was proven to minimize the high wind loads by as much as half, compared to the wind loads without the deflector. Working Principles of a Solar Cell

Conceptually, the operating principle of a solar cell can be summarized as follows. Sunlight is absorbed in a material in which electrons can have two energy levels, one low and one high.
